Rep Power: 7 ![]() | Alot of themes the WWF use is jsut basic library stock that is free for all media to use. Kurt Angles music is actually the old music of 'The Patriot' if i remember. Ive also hears the hardy boys music in a few commericals. Ric Flairs music is also library material. Only the top tier stars seem to get dedicated theme songs in this day and age (Rock, Austin, HHH etc). Its alot more common now since they fired their 'in-house' composer |
